William Wallace Wagner, age 73, of 88 Valley View Place,Tiffin, Ohio, died at 2:30 a.m. Thursday, April 3, 2003, at his residence.
He was born March 17, 1930, in Leipsic, Ohio, to the late John E. and Helen (Barger) Wagner. His wife, Norma J. (Werling) Wagner, whom he married October 25, 1952, in St. Mary Catholic Church, Tiffin, survives.
Other survivors include: three sons, Dr. William M. (Sandra) Wagner, Michael A. (Janet) Wagner, and Dr. Robert J. (Anita) Wagner; two daughters, Patricia A. (John) Traunero and Sharon M. (Kevin) Frontz; six grandchildren, Autumn (Jeff) Hoover, Austin Wagner, Justin and Kelsey Traunero, and Sydney and Quinn Frontz; two brothers, John C. (Rosemary) Wagner and Richard J.(Lois) Wagner; and three sisters, Mary L. Wagner, Eileen (Dewey) DeTray, and Catherine (Charles) Culichia.
A 1949 Calvert graduate, Mr. Wagner retired in 1991 after 40 years as sales delivery for Klepper's Distribution. He enjoyed hunting and observing the activities in Hedges-Boyer Park. He was a member of St. Joseph Catholic Church.
